Has anyone else had trouble getting the guide rows to increase? I had no issues on Win7 x86, but on a new build Win7 x64 the number of rows will not budge, it's stuck at 7 no matter what I set it to in MCL XL.

Post by jjwatmyself » Sat Apr 05, 2014 5:09 pm

mrphil wrote:Has anyone else had trouble getting the guide rows to increase? I had no issues on Win7 x86, but on a new build Win7 x64 the number of rows will not budge, it's stuck at 7 no matter what I set it to in MCL XL.
Known bug when used in conjunction with MCE Master. Both developers have worked to resolve and awaiting new version release. It's been a couple of months since I heard the resolution was identified.
